The Magistralinvest company launched on Tuesday in Kolomna, a Moscow region, a complex for processing glass waste into raw materials for the production of glass containers and building materials. This was reported by the press service of the Corporation for the Development of Small and Medium Enterprises (SMEs), with the support of which the project was implemented.
"The grand opening of the complex took place, the project operator is the Magistralinvest company, which also produces innovative, high-tech equipment for processing glass waste. SME Bank (a subsidiary of SME Corporation - approx. TASS) in 2018 provided financial support for the construction of a plant for 52 million rubles for a period of seven years under the program of concessional lending to small and medium-sized enterprises, "the report said.
The launch of the project, investments in which are not specified, helped to create 45 jobs. On one production line, sorting, crushing, cleaning, material separation into fractions and loading of finished raw materials into soft containers takes place. In addition, there is a line for processing thermoplastic bottles into crumbs. As a result of the processing of glass waste, raw materials are obtained that are ready for the production of glass containers and building materials, for example, insulation.
The consumer of the product will be the French construction company Saint-Gobain. "Our joint work with Russian and foreign partners allows us to expand our sales markets and increase the competitiveness of domestic small and medium-sized enterprises," the press service quoted Yevgeny Ivliev, Deputy Director General of SME Corporation.
Oleg Burakov, Advisor to the Chairman of the Board of SME Bank, noted that the technologies that Magistralinvest uses in its activities "must be scaled up and the bank is ready for further cooperation."
